Annual Return

It is a directors responsibility to submit an Annual Return (Form 363) to the Registrar of Companies within 28 days of the company's 'return date' (this is the anniversary of its incorporation or the anniversary of its previous return date.

The Annual Return is designed to keep the information held at Companies House up to date. The Annual Return includes information such as registered office address, members details, officer's details and the company's main business activities amongst other details.

Companies House levies a filing fee of £30 for filing an Annual Return in paper forms by post, or £15 for filing an Annual Return electronically.
